What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ing refers to using 2 panes of glass that are separated by a space filled with argon gas or a vacuum. This style produces an insulating barrier that helps keep indoor temperature levels, decreases noise, and reduce energy expenses.
Advantages of Double Glazing
The advantages of double glazing are many and can be classified into the following:

Energy Efficiency: Double glazing significantly reduces heat loss throughout winter season and decreases heat gain in summertime, resulting in lower energy consumption and heating expenses.

Sound Insulation: The double-pane style can effectively block external noises, developing a quieter living environment.

Increased Security: Cheap double Glazing installation-glazed windows are much harder to break than single-glazed units, making it harder for burglars to go into.

Minimized Condensation: The insulating residential or commercial properties of double glazing help lower condensation on window surface areas.

Ecological Impact: By reducing energy intake, double glazing adds to a lower carbon footprint.

Can I set up double glazing myself?
While it is possible to install double glazing as a DIY task, it is suggested to work with an expert. Appropriate setup is essential to make the most of energy effectiveness and make sure that the windows are protected.
2. For how long does installation take?
The setup process can take anywhere from a few hours to a few days, depending upon the variety of windows being changed and the intricacy of the installation.
3. Will double glazing help in reducing my energy costs?
Yes, double glazing can substantially lower energy costs by preventing heat loss in winter season and heat gain in summer season, thus increasing energy performance.
4. What type of double glazing is best?
The very best type of double glazing depends upon your specific needs, budget, and aesthetic preferences. Consult with a professional to determine the best choices customized to your home.
5. What upkeep does double glazing require?
Double glazing is low-maintenance but requires regular cleaning and periodic assessments to make sure that seals are intact and devoid of mold or damage.
